Who We Are

Electric empowers small and medium-sized businesses with everything they need to take control of their IT and security environment.

Our best-in-class software provides SMBs with the insights and tools to make IT easy (even if you’re not an IT expert)! From mobile device management to employee onboarding and offboarding, SMBs can manage their IT with transparency and confidence in the Electric IT Hub.

Overview

We are seeking a highly skilled and proactive Senior Product Support Specialist to join our Product Support team. As a Senior Product Support Specialist, you will be a primary point of contact for complex customer inquiries, providing expert-level support, in-depth triaging, and effective resolution. The ideal candidate will possess exceptional communication and interpersonal skills, advanced problem-solving abilities honed through significant experience, and a deep-seated passion for ensuring customer satisfaction. You will be a key contributor within our dynamic team focused on the success, retention, and expansion of our customer base, leveraging your expertise to guide junior team members and contribute to the continuous improvement of our support processes.

What You’ll Do:

  • Serve as a primary point of contact for complex and escalated customer inquiries, ensuring timely and professional communication.

  • Independently troubleshoot and resolve intricate technical and functional product issues, often requiring in-depth investigation and creative solutions.

  • Proactively identify, document, and escalate critical customer issues and potential product defects to Engineering and Product Management teams, providing detailed context and recommendations.

  • Lead in the creation and maintenance of internal and external knowledge base articles, troubleshooting guides, and FAQs to empower both customers and the Support team.

  • Mentor and provide guidance to Product Support Specialists, fostering their technical and customer service skills.

  • Help identify trends in customer issues and provide insightful feedback to the product and development teams to drive product improvements and prevent future problems.

  • Collaborate effectively with Engineering, Product Management, Sales, and Customer Success teams to ensure seamless customer experiences and efficient issue resolution.

  • Contribute to the development and implementation of best practices, processes, and tools to enhance the efficiency and effectiveness of the product support function.

  • Continuously expand your product knowledge and technical expertise to effectively support new features and product updates.

Who You Are:

  • Minimum of 3-4 years of experience in a customer-facing technical support or product support role within a technology company, with a proven track record of resolving complex issues.

  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to explain technical concepts clearly and concisely to both technical and non-technical audiences.

  • Able to work largely independently by leveraging documentation, tooling, and error logs to perform most investigations and evaluations.

  • Demonstrated ability to troubleshoot and investigate complex technical issues, including leveraging tools like Datadog to determine root cause and steps to remediation.

  • Exceptional and professional customer service skills with a demonstrated ability to build rapport and trust with customers and coworkers.

  • Experience coaching or assisting front line team members with cases and investigations, preferred.

  • Experience operating within a ticketing system, Jira Service Management preferred.

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ene

San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
  •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
  •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
